Waiting for emergency vet but while I do what are your thoughts - since I can't stop stressing!
All four legs triple usual size, very lame and rocked back on heels (looks laminitic), slight heat in feet, can't feel digital pulse but possibly because legs are so swollen. Shaking slightly and slight laboured breathing but I suspect is due to the pain. Has come on suddenly. Gums are pink, eating and drinking (slightly less than usual but is struggling to move around to get to it), pooing.
Horse living out 24/7 so was getting plenty of movement - gateway is thick mud but large field with good grass cover so not standing in mud all the time. No sign of cuts/scrapes/scabs (I was wondering lymphangitis). No contact with other horses other than one healthy field mate. Up to date on jabs. Have increased feed over the last week and it is quite high sugar content in chaff. Never had laminitis before and in healthy body condition.
